A Bonus Army was the popular name for the more than 43,000 U.S. World War I veterans who gathered in Washington, D.C. in the summer of 1932 to demand immediate payment of bonuses promised to them by Congress in 1924 for their service in the war. There are six civil affairs functional areas that are critical to support to civil administration: rule of law, economic stability, infrastructure, governance, public education and information, and public health and welfare.
